If the stationary section is more polar when compared to the cellular section, the separation is deemed ordinary stage. If the stationary stage is a lot less polar as opposed to cell stage, the separation is reverse section. In reverse stage HPLC the retention time of the compound will increase with reducing polarity of the particular species. The real key to a good and successful separation is to determine the appropriate ratio concerning polar and non-polar elements in the cellular section.

Typical section HPLC is barely almost never used now, almost all HPLC separation may be performed in reverse section. Reverse period HPLC (RPLC) is ineffective in for just a few separation varieties; it are unable to separate inorganic ions (they may be separated by ion exchange chromatography). It cannot different polysaccharides (These are way too hydrophilic for just about any strong section adsorption to happen), nor polynucleotides (they adsorb irreversibly to the reverse period packing). And finally, extremely hydrophobic compounds can not be separated effectively by RPLC (You can find little selectivity).
